Definitions:

Peripheral Vision

The portion of vision that occurs outside the direct line of sight, enabling humans to detect movement and objects around them without directly looking at them.

Rods

In the eye, rod-shaped receptors of light that are sensitive to intensity only. Rods permit black-and-white vision.

Newborns

Refers to infants from birth to about 2 months of age, characterized by rapid physical and neurological development.

Depth Perception

The ability to perceive the distance of an object and the spatial relationship between objects in the environment.
